The Advisory Council on Economic Growth says Canada must choose a small number of promising sectors for growth as the US, UK, New Zealand and Australia have done with varying degrees of success. And while the council does not provide a specific list, it does single out agriculture and food, energy and renewables, mining and metals, healthcare and life sciences, advanced manufacturing, financial services, tourism and education as the best bets.
